2026 PORSCHE PANAMERA Safety Overview

The 2026 PORSCHE PANAMERA has been closely monitored for safety issues.

Official NHTSA Recalls

The NHTSA has issued 2 official safety recalls for this vehicle. Key affected components include:

  • Fuel system, gasoline:delivery:fuel pump
  • Suspension:front:macpherson strut

Severe Defect Warnings

Notably, some of these defects carry severe risks, such as a fuel leak in the presence of an ignition source increases the risk of a fire.

2026 PORSCHE PANAMERA 25V634000

Porsche Cars North America, Inc.

A fuel leak in the presence of an ignition source increases the risk of a fire.

2026 PORSCHE PANAMERA 25V415000

Porsche Cars North America, Inc.

An air suspension strut failure may cause a loss of vehicle handling and control, increasing the risk of a crash.
